PRE-PROCEDURE

1. Cardioversion: Day of Procedure: ________________________

2. NPO status:

q NPO now and confirm patient has been NPO after midnight (patient coming from home)

q NPO after midnight except medications for cardioversion tomorrow (patient in hospital)

q NPO now for cardioversion today (patient in hospital)

3. STAT Diagnostics: STAT Labs: q CBC, q Chem 7, q Magnesium level

q PT / INR q PTT q Anti Xa (Heparin level)

Notify physician if K+ < 3.7 or INR < 2.0

4. ECG 12-lead Reason: Pre Cardioversion, cardiac arrhythmia evaluation, Read by _________________

5. Urine hCG for any menstruating female ≥ 12 years of age

6. Blood glucose finger stick prior to procedure (Diabetic patient)

7. Venous Access: INT to right arm, if possible and no current IV access

8. Normal Saline IV at KVO rate, start immediately prior to procedure

9. O2 per protocol (# 34431)

10. q OUTPATIENT POST-PROCEDURE ORDERS

STAT ECG 12 lead Reason: Status Post Cardioversion, Read by: __________________

May go home when discharge criteria met:

· Able to tolerate PO fluids

· PAR score ≥ 9 or at pre-procedure level. If PAR ≤ 8 discharge by Physician orders.

· Ambulate with minimal assistance

11. q INPATIENT POST PROCEDURE ORDERS

STAT ECG 12 lead Reason: Status Post Cardioversion, Read by___________________

Resume previous diet when awake and alert

Return to floor when PAR score ≥ 9 or at pre-procedure level. If PAR ≤ 8, discharge by Physician orders.

Vital Signs upon returning to unit and per unit routine

Up with assist first time out of bed, then PRN
